数值分析公式全览:从误差到插值法
需积分: 34 177 浏览量
更新于2024-09-08
3
收藏 807KB PDF 举报
"数值分析公式大全,包含了数值分析中的重要概念和计算方法,适用于期末复习和考研准备。"
在数值分析中,我们首先关注的是误差的度量。相对误差和绝对误差是衡量数值近似值与真实值之间差异的常用指标。相对误差e*定义为x*减去真实值x的绝对值除以真实值x,即e* = (x* - x) / x。而误差限ε*则是给定的误差最大可能范围,相对误差限εr*则是相对误差的最大可能范围,通常表示为εr* ≤ ε*/|x|。
有效数字的概念用于描述近似值的精度。一个近似值x*有n位有效数字,意味着它的误差限不超过最后一位的半个单位,并且它由n位数字表示,包括一个非零的首位数字a1,后面跟着n-1个数字ai,以及一个指数m,即x* = ±10^m × (a1 + a2 × 10^(-1) + a3 × 10^(-2) + ... + an × 10^(-n+1))。相对误差限公式表示为:如果εr* ≤ 10^(-n+1),则x*至少有n位有效数字。
病态问题是数值分析中的一大挑战,条件数(Cp)是用来衡量这类问题敏感性的指标。当一个函数f(x)对输入x的微小变化产生大幅变化时,我们认为它是病态的。函数值f(x*)的相对误差可以用x的扰动Δx=(x-x*)来表示,相对误差比值定义为Δf/f ≈ Cp,其中Cp是条件数,反映了函数对输入变化的放大程度。
在数值插值方面,多项式插值是寻找一个多项式P(x)来逼近给定数据点的方法。线性插值是最简单的形式,通过两个数据点构造一个一次多项式,插值基函数L1由节点之间的差商给出。抛物线插值涉及三个数据点,构建二次多项式。更一般地,N次插值多项式Ln通过解一组线性方程得到,每个系数对应于一个插值条件。拉格朗日插值是构造插值多项式的一种常用方法,通过拉格朗日基多项式实现。余项公式Rn=f(x)-Ln(x) 描述了插值多项式与实际函数f(x)的偏差,其截断误差限可以通过最高阶导数的界Mn+1估算。
均差或差商是数值微分的基础,它们提供了用节点上的函数值近似导数的方法。一阶、二阶直至高阶的均差都可以通过节点上的函数值线性组合得到,并具有对称性和与节点次序无关的性质。最重要的是,n阶均差与函数在区间[a, b]内的n阶导数有关,这为数值微分提供了理论基础。
牛顿插值多项式是通过逐次生成低阶插值多项式来构建的,每次增加一个数据点,形成一个新多项式,直到达到所需的插值阶数。这种方法可以逐步构造出精确通过所有数据点的多项式。
以上就是数值分析中的关键概念和公式,涵盖了误差分析、有效数字、病态问题、多项式插值和数值微分等方面,这些知识对于理解和解决实际计算问题至关重要。
2020-08-27 上传
2021-10-01 上传
2013-03-17 上传
2021-10-06 上传
2009-05-16 上传
东西南北风wind
- 粉丝: 3
- 资源: 5
最新资源
- NIST REFPROP问题反馈与解决方案存储库
- 掌握LeetCode习题的系统开源答案
- ctop:实现汉字按首字母拼音分类排序的PHP工具
- 微信小程序课程学习——投资融资类产品说明
- Matlab犯罪模拟器开发:探索《当蛮力失败》犯罪惩罚模型
- Java网上招聘系统实战项目源码及部署教程
- OneSky APIPHP5库:PHP5.1及以上版本的API集成
- 实时监控MySQL导入进度的bash脚本技巧
- 使用MATLAB开发交流电压脉冲生成控制系统
- ESP32安全OTA更新:原生API与WebSocket加密传输
- Sonic-Sharp: 基于《刺猬索尼克》的开源C#游戏引擎
- Java文章发布系统源码及部署教程
- CQUPT Python课程代码资源完整分享
- 易语言实现获取目录尺寸的Scripting.FileSystemObject对象方法
- Excel宾果卡生成器:自定义和打印多张卡片
- 使用HALCON实现图像二维码自动读取与解码